Grey is the queen of colours, because it makes everything else look good. It is the lightest shade of black- the colour of mystery, blended with white- the colour of purity, grey is the colour of compromise, wisdom and maturity. It represents neutrality and this influence keeps it foreign, remote and distant, from people and other colours. It is considered to be an emotionless, timeless and moody colour. However it is also modest, intellectual, dignified and hard-working.
Grey is associated with the Kaalratri form of Durga, also known as Shubhankari, which means dark knight. The goddess is said to protect her worshipers from evil.

It is the colour of the cement which is used to hold the bricks together, on which our buildings stand tall. All buildings before being made colourful are grey. It is the colour of architecture, commerce and Industry.
It is thought to be a colour of maturation as when we grow old, silvering towards the evening of life, our hair turns grey; it shows this colour is full of life experiences and wisdom.
A lot of mature product companies use grey in their designs to make impactful products. Electronic product companies tend to incline towards this colour more to make their products seamless and ergonomic.
